[vbox-dev] current svn build failure

JusTiCe8 justice8 at wanadoo.fr
Thu Jul 26 14:23:22 GMT 2007


I see this error is due to a pb in kmk tool itself ("best->bytesfree > 
len" suggest a not enough memory condition but there is plenty of memory 
available 849 MB used on 1.98 GB total).

Debug output from kmk if it could help:

...
[2:0/1]start_waiting_job 0x80fd8c8 (`pass_bldprogs_before') 
command_flags=0x20 slots=0/1
[2:0/1]not_parallel 0 -> 1 (file=0x80f7018 `pass_bldprogs_before') 
[start_waiting_job]
kmk[2]: Entering directory `/usr/local/tarballs/vbox/src/libs'
kBuild Make 0.1.0

Based on GNU Make 3.81.90:
 Copyright (C) 2006  Free Software Foundation, Inc.

kBuild Modifications:
 Copyright (C) 2005-2006  Knut St. Osmundsen.

kmkbuiltin commands derived from *BSD sources:
 Copyright (c) 1983 1987, 1988, 1989, 1990, 1991, 1992, 1993, 1994
  The Regents of the University of California. All rights reserved.
 Copyright (c) 1998  Todd C. Miller <Todd.Miller at courtesan.com>

This is free software; see the source for copying conditions.
There is NO warranty; not even for MERCHANTABILITY or FITNESS FOR A
PARTICULAR PURPOSE.

PATH_KBUILD:     '/usr/local/tarballs/vbox/kBuild'
PATH_KBUILD_BIN: '/usr/local/tarballs/vbox/kBuild/bin/linux.x86'

This program is built for linux/x86/blend [Jun 11 2007 16:44:15]
[3:0/1]Reading makefiles...
Reading makefile `Makefile.kmk'...
Reading makefile `/usr/local/tarballs/vbox/kBuild/header.kmk' (search 
path) (no ~ expansion)...
Reading makefile `../../../Config.kmk' (search path) (no ~ expansion)...
Reading makefile `/usr/local/tarballs/vbox/AutoConfig.kmk' (search path) 
(no ~ expansion)...
Reading makefile `/usr/local/tarballs/vbox/kBuild/tools/GXX3.kmk' 
(search path) (no ~ expansion)...
Reading makefile 
`/usr/local/tarballs/vbox/out/linux.x86/release/GCCConfig.kmk' (search 
path) (no ~ expansion)...
[2:0/1]Putting child 0x080fd8c8 (pass_bldprogs_before) PID 6254 on the 
chain.
[2:1/1]Live child 0x080fd8c8 (pass_bldprogs_before) PID 6254
Reading makefile `/usr/local/tarballs/vbox/kBuild/footer.kmk' (search 
path) (no ~ expansion)...
kmk: /home/vbox/kBuild/trunk/src/kmk/strcache.c:87: add_string:  
l'assertion « best->bytesfree > len » a échoué.
[2:1/1]Reaping losing child 0x080fd8c8 PID 6254
kmk[2]: *** [pass_bldprogs_before] Abandon
[2:1/1]notice_finished_file - entering: file=0x80f7018 
`pass_bldprogs_before' update_status=2 command_state=2
[2:1/1]not_parallel 1 -> 0 (file=0x80f7018 `pass_bldprogs_before') 
[notice_finished_file]
[2:1/1]Removing child 0x080fd8c8 PID 6254 from chain.
kmk[2]: Leaving directory `/usr/local/tarballs/vbox/src/libs'
[1:1/1]Reaping losing child 0x08101380 PID 6253
kmk[1]: *** [pass_bldprogs_before] Error 2
[1:1/1]notice_finished_file - entering: file=0x80f76b0 
`pass_bldprogs_before' update_status=2 command_state=2
[1:1/1]not_parallel 1 -> 0 (file=0x80f76b0 `pass_bldprogs_before') 
[notice_finished_file]
[1:1/1]Removing child 0x08101380 PID 6253 from chain.
kmk[1]: Leaving directory `/usr/local/tarballs/vbox/src'
...

finally , this is md5 sum of tool: bdc2104bf2b8ad396d50482004db6dc2   
(for linux.x86)

Regards.






More information about the vbox-dev mailing list